Over two hundred years ago, American Patriots fought and sacrificed for the freedoms we enjoy today. Through participation in the Society’s programs and activities you can continue this legacy by actively supporting historic preservation and promoting educational and patriotic endeavors. Any woman 18 years or older regardless of race, religion, or ethnic background, who can prove lineal descent from a patriot of the American Revolution, is eligible for membership. NSDAR Motto: God, Home, Country

DAR Schools and DAR Approved Schools
At our January 2016 meeting Chaplain Faye Sliger presented her program on DAR Schools and DAR Approved Schools. The DAR Schools are Kate Duncan Smith in Alabama and Tamassee in South Carolina. The DAR Approved Schools are Hillside School Massachusetts, Hindeman Settlement School in Kentucky, Berry College in Georgia and the Crossnore School in North Carolina. Faye shared information about each of the schools and encouraged us to visit them.
